Police Appeal After Bellaghy Burglary and Car Theft
Police are investigating a burglary in Bellaghy, County Londonderry, during which a car was stolen and later found crashed overnight.
Shortly before 2am on Sunday 9 August 2026, officers were alerted to a vehicle being driven dangerously on the Mullaghboy Road. The car left the road and collided with a field before the driver fled the scene at speed.
Subsequent enquiries revealed the vehicle had been taken from outside a nearby home. An intruder had entered the property and made off with the keys.
At approximately 2.40am, the damaged car was discovered abandoned near the intersection of Old Tyanee Road and Glenone Road. No one was present at the location.
Detectives have appealed for anyone who was in the area around the time of the incidents to come forward. They are particularly interested in dash-cam, CCTV or other footage. Information can be submitted via the online witness appeal form, quoting reference 213 09/08/26.
